THE INSTITUTE FOR POLICY STUDIES (THE INSTITUTE) IS A 59-YEAR-OLD ORGANIZATION THAT IS DEDICATED TO BUILDING A MORE EQUITABLE, ECOLOGICALLY SUSTAINABLE, AND PEACEFUL SOCIETY. IN PARTNERSHIP WITH DYNAMIC SOCIAL MOVEMENTS, IT TURNS TRANSFORMATIVE POLICY IDEAS INTO ACTION.
